herbrich19
Goto Top

Python NewLine im Network Stream

Hallo,

Ich versuche ein für ein UPnP Server SSDP zu implementieren. Nun ja, wen ich mit einen Sniffer reinschaue was ankommt; alles zusammen gepapt und keine neuen Zeilen.
Meine Python Source

import socket
import struct
import time

def send():
        MCAST_GRP = '239.255.255.250'  
        MCAST_PORT = 1900
        sock = socket.socket(socket.AF_INET, socket.SOCK_DGRAM)
        sock.setsockopt(socket.IPPROTO_IP, socket.IP_MULTICAST_TTL, 2)
        sock.bind((MCAST_GRP,MCAST_PORT))
        data = """NOTIFY * HTTP/1.1\n\n  
SERVER: Jennifer Herbrich / UPNP1.0 JH-UKE W37 PA1 PA4 Borderline Server PA14\n\n
CACHE-CONTROL: max-age=1800\n\n
LOCATION: http://10.141.0.15:80/description.xml\n\n
NTS: ssdp:alive\n\n
NT: urn:schemas-upnp-org:device:BinaryLight:1\n\n
USN: uuid:550e8414-e29b-11d4-a716-446655442147::urn:schemas-upnp-org:device:BinaryLight:1\n\n
HOST: 10.141.0.15:1900\n\n
"""  
        sock.sendto(data,(MCAST_GRP, MCAST_PORT))

while 1:
        send()
        time.sleep(1)

Gruß an die IT-Welt,
J Herbrich

Content-Key: 326327

Url: https://administrator.de/contentid/326327

Ausgedruckt am: 19.03.2024 um 09:03 Uhr